What Is City Holder?
City Holder is a blockchain-integrated city-building game that allows players to manage, expand, and optimize a virtual town. Unlike traditional city simulation games, City Holder introduces crypto-based rewards and token incentives into its core mechanics.
Players are not only responsible for constructing and upgrading buildings but also for managing economic growth, population expansion, and strategic planning. The game combines elements of economics, strategy, and entertainment, making it accessible to casual gamers while still offering depth for those interested in long-term optimization.
Built primarily for Telegram users, City Holder reflects a broader trend in Web3 gaming, where lightweight platforms are used to onboard new users into blockchain ecosystems without requiring complex setups or technical knowledge.

How the Daily Combo Works
The Daily Combo is one of the easiest ways for City Holder players to earn tokens consistently.
To participate, players must open the City Holder game through Telegram and navigate to the “Your City” section. From there, selecting the “Combo” tab reveals the daily task, which consists of upgrading specific buildings in the correct order.
Each day, players are given three attempts to choose the correct combination. Successfully completing the combo rewards players with up to 7.5 million in-game tokens, significantly boosting their virtual economy and leaderboard standing.
If all three attempts are used without success, the reward for that day is forfeited. This mechanic encourages players to seek verified combo information and approach upgrades strategically rather than guessing randomly.

Types of Buildings Featured in Daily Combos
City Holder’s Daily Combo can involve several categories of buildings, each playing a unique role in city development.
Residential buildings increase population capacity and unlock new gameplay features as the city grows. A larger population often leads to higher activity and additional opportunities for economic expansion.
Commercial buildings focus on generating steady income. These structures help stabilize the city’s finances and support long-term growth by providing reliable revenue streams.
Industrial buildings increase productivity and economic output. They often play a key role in scaling a city’s economy and supporting higher-level upgrades across other sectors.
Special buildings offer unique benefits. These may include attracting tourists, generating bonus tokens, or unlocking temporary boosts that give players an edge in daily challenges.
Understanding how each building type contributes to the overall system helps players make smarter decisions when completing Daily Combos.
How to Participate in the Daily Quiz
In addition to the Daily Combo, City Holder offers a Daily Quiz feature designed to test players’ knowledge of the game.
The quiz typically consists of simple questions related to City Holder mechanics, gameplay features, or general blockchain concepts. Answering correctly allows players to earn additional rewards, reinforcing learning while keeping engagement high.
Like the Daily Combo, the quiz resets every 24 hours, encouraging players to check in regularly.
